Transaction 64d1643d5db46c153738b0d0a4265381ef68a9f6c31cec89f60f3dd05ef0da71

1 Input
2 Outputs
  • 64d1643d5db46c153738b0d0a4265381ef68a9f6c31cec89f60f3dd05ef0da71:0
  • value  252688
    address  32Rheey7LBLchKwwUgX7XeWxvLCbm9ZwXs
  • 64d1643d5db46c153738b0d0a4265381ef68a9f6c31cec89f60f3dd05ef0da71:1
  • value  14882152553
    address  3LdS6xhAuzjd3fBKdxtLLC1cv2JbzPqutw